Arquebuse Liqueur is a sublime distilled creation presented in elegant 50cl bottles, accompanied by a refined case that enhances its image. This unique liqueur, derived from a traditional recipe preserved over time, is a tribute to the mastery of ancient herbalists.

Its composition is based on a meticulous selection of aromatic herbs, whose recipe has been jealously guarded for centuries. Each sip of Arquebuse offers a sensory journey through a bouquet of aromas and flavors that linger in the memory. Among these, delicate notes of chamomile, mint, lavender, and other alpine herbs emerge, creating a perfect balance between sweetness and bitterness.

The distillation follows traditional methods, which preserve the integrity and purity of the natural ingredients, ensuring a product of superior quality. The color of the liqueur is clearly natural, a delicate straw yellow that suggests its elegance and purity.

Arquebuse Liqueur is ideally served as a digestive, to be enjoyed at the end of a meal for its beneficial effect on the digestive system. Additionally, thanks to its aromatic complexity, it can also be used in innovative cocktails that desire a distinctive aromatic touch.

To fully appreciate its qualities, it is recommended to serve it slightly chilled, thus enhancing its rich texture of flavors. Each carefully cased bottle also makes an excellent choice as a refined gift for connoisseurs and those wishing to discover distillery traditions of excellence.

Discover the spirits, production style and story of Montanaro.

Historic distillery in Alba (Fraz. Gallo, CN) specialized in single-varietal grappa, vintage grappe and brandy; also produces vermouth, aperitifs and natural bitters made with artisanal methods and steam-heated copper stills.

Distillation

Batch distillation in steam-heated copper stills; demethylation and fraction separation with a double column.

Ageing

Aging in wooden barrels for grappas and aged brandies (ranges from 18 to many years for the vintage bottlings); use of traditional casks and, for some references, century-old casks or Slavonian oak.
